The 1N3170 diode belongs to the category of semiconductor devices.
It is commonly used in electronic circuits for rectification, voltage regulation, and signal demodulation.
The 1N3170 diode is typically available in a DO-41 package.
This diode serves as a crucial component in electronic circuits, enabling the conversion of alternating current (AC) to direct current (DC).
It is commonly sold in reels or tubes containing multiple units, with quantities varying based on manufacturer specifications.
The 1N3170 diode has two pins, anode, and cathode. The anode is denoted by a longer lead or a notch on the diode body, while the cathode is marked with a band near the cathode end.
The 1N3170 diode operates based on the principle of unidirectional conduction, allowing current flow in only one direction. When a positive voltage is applied to the anode with respect to the cathode, the diode conducts, allowing current to flow through it. In the reverse bias condition, the diode blocks the flow of current.
The 1N3170 diode finds extensive application in: - Power supply units - Voltage regulators - Rectifier circuits - Inverter systems - Signal demodulation circuits
